Добро пожаловать!

Войдите или зарегистрируйтесь сейчас!

Войти

Вопросы по QGIS

Тема в разделе "QGIS/NEXTGIS", создана пользователем Koba88, 26 фев 2017.

  1. ErnieBoyd

    Форумчанин

    Регистрация:
    10 июн 2014
    Сообщения:
    271
    Симпатии:
    159
    С вырезанием прямоугольной области я погорячился. Эта операция элементарно делается средствами QGIS. В диалоге сохранения копии открытого растра границы сохраняемой области бросаются в глаза.
    Screenshot_2018-10-21_19-59-16.png
     
    #21
  2. wolodya

    Форумчанин

    Регистрация:
    1 янв 2009
    Сообщения:
    6.618
    Симпатии:
    2.440
    Адрес:
    Москва
    Попробовал - обрезает прямоугольник с горизонтальными и вертикальными сторонами.
    А у меня вот так в результате трансформации и обрезать надо под наклоном.
    Screenshot_1.png
     
    #22
  3. X-Y-H

    X-Y-H Администратор
    Команда форума Форумчанин

    Регистрация:
    18 май 2007
    Сообщения:
    21.791
    Симпатии:
    7.068
    Адрес:
    Россия
    Люди а в QGIS размеры проставлять можно как в CAD программах?
     
    #23
  4. trir

    Форумчанин

    Регистрация:
    25 ноя 2014
    Сообщения:
    3.253
    Симпатии:
    931
    Адрес:
    gnomtrir@mail.ru
    нет, это не CAD-программа
     
    #24
  5. ErnieBoyd

    Форумчанин

    Регистрация:
    10 июн 2014
    Сообщения:
    271
    Симпатии:
    159
    Давайте так. Создаём шейп полигонального типа.
    ВНИМАНИЕ!!! Система координат должна быть такая же, как у растра!
    Пусть шейп зовут "border". Рисуем полигон, сохраняем шейп.
    Screenshot_2018-10-23_19-06-46.png
    В меню тычем
    [Растр] → [Извлечение] → [Обрезка]
    Выбираем обрезку слоем маски, указываем "border".
    Если поднять флажок "Охват целевого слоя по линии обрезки", срежутся ненужные поля по краям.
    Screenshot_2018-10-23_19-31-55.png
    Жмём [OK]. GDAL создаст растр с прозрачными краями, добавив альфа-канал. Новый растр будет относиться к типу RGBA, а не RGB. По идее, это должны понимать разные программы, работающие с растрами. Вот я в свойствах проекта QGIS сделал зелёный фон:
    Screenshot_2018-10-23_19-43-00.png
    А вот так показывает растр простенький просмотрщик графики:
    Screenshot_2018-10-23_19-44-32.png
    Что знают нужные Вам программы о современных форматах растров, вот в чём вопрос.
     
    #25
  6. X-Y-H

    X-Y-H Администратор
    Команда форума Форумчанин

    Регистрация:
    18 май 2007
    Сообщения:
    21.791
    Симпатии:
    7.068
    Адрес:
    Россия
    Плохо.
     
    #26
  7. ErnieBoyd

    Форумчанин

    Регистрация:
    10 июн 2014
    Сообщения:
    271
    Симпатии:
    159
    Можно. Есть плагин QAD, у которого среди CAD плюшек есть и простановка размеров. А есть плагин Dimensioning, который только для этой задачи и создан.
     
    #27
  8. X-Y-H

    X-Y-H Администратор
    Команда форума Форумчанин

    Регистрация:
    18 май 2007
    Сообщения:
    21.791
    Симпатии:
    7.068
    Адрес:
    Россия
    А может и плагин вьюпортов есть?
     
    #28
  9. Луговский

    Форумчанин

    Регистрация:
    30 авг 2011
    Сообщения:
    277
    Симпатии:
    87
    Адрес:
    Санкт-Петербург
    Это в основе, называется макет или composer. В режиме «атлас» - супер! Создал шаблон макета с отображением , например координатных сеток, а дальше автоматически прорисовывает их по планшетам.
     
    #29
  10. ErnieBoyd

    Форумчанин

    Регистрация:
    10 июн 2014
    Сообщения:
    271
    Симпатии:
    159
    Макет соответствует автокадовскому Layout.
    За вьюпорты не скажу, не вижу в них пользы в ГИСах, т. к. основная нагрузка на карты 2D/2.5D.
     
    #30
  11. wolodya

    Форумчанин

    Регистрация:
    1 янв 2009
    Сообщения:
    6.618
    Симпатии:
    2.440
    Адрес:
    Москва
    Я в QGIS и вообще с работой с растрами мало знаком.
    Шейп полигонального типа это - вот это?
    Screenshot_1.png
    А как там полигон создать?

    Все это дело вставляю в программу Credo Топограф. Какие форматы растров она поддерживает даже не знаю.
     
    #31
  12. ErnieBoyd

    Форумчанин

    Регистрация:
    10 июн 2014
    Сообщения:
    271
    Симпатии:
    159
    Да, вот это. Только система координат должна быть такая же, как у растра. Если там СК-95 зона 7, её и надо выбрать - EPSG:20007 "Pulkovo 1995 / Gauss-Kruger zone 7".

    В панели слоёв шейп-файл должен быть текущим. Находим на панели "Инструменты оцифровки" кнопку "Режим редактирования" и жмём. Рядом жмём кнопку "Добавить объект". Левой кнопкой мышки добавляем углы полигона, правой кнопкой завершаем операцию. Отжимаем кнопку "Режим редактирования", в диалоге выбираем [Сохранить].
     
    #32
  13. wolodya

    Форумчанин

    Регистрация:
    1 янв 2009
    Сообщения:
    6.618
    Симпатии:
    2.440
    Адрес:
    Москва
    #33
  14. ErnieBoyd

    Форумчанин

    Регистрация:
    10 июн 2014
    Сообщения:
    271
    Симпатии:
    159
    wolodya, слой "111.shp" не был сохранён, поэтому он пустой, и растровая утилита не видит в нём объектов.

    И неужели у растра система координат EPSG:4284 "Pulkovo 1942"? Это же географическая СК, т. е. долгота/широта.
     
    #34
  15. wolodya

    Форумчанин

    Регистрация:
    1 янв 2009
    Сообщения:
    6.618
    Симпатии:
    2.440
    Адрес:
    Москва
    Теперь обрезает но получается черный квадрат.
    https://yadi.sk/i/-d4raCtVWpJLuA
     
    #35
  16. X-Y-H

    X-Y-H Администратор
    Команда форума Форумчанин

    Регистрация:
    18 май 2007
    Сообщения:
    21.791
    Симпатии:
    7.068
    Адрес:
    Россия
    wolodya, растр однобитный?
     
    #36
  17. Izekinvitro

    Регистрация:
    24 июл 2018
    Сообщения:
    17
    Симпатии:
    2
    Вопрос!
    Надо нанести на план полигоны с вершинами в заданных координатах в WGS84. Подключен слой спутниковых снимков от Bing. При нанесении точечных shape-файлов при редктировании их место положения программа использует координаты вида 52 45.358 ; 39 44.573. При редактировании вершин полигонов используются координаты вида 4423756.78,6927529.08 . В настройках такой вывод называется Map units, меняется в настройках системы координат в проекте, но при редактировании вершин сделать с этим ничего нельзя... Системы координат везде: в проекте, в слоях, везде где нашел, одинаковые, но в итоге результат один. Как отредактировать вершины по координатам WGS 84?
     
    #37
  18. wolodya

    Форумчанин

    Регистрация:
    1 янв 2009
    Сообщения:
    6.618
    Симпатии:
    2.440
    Адрес:
    Москва
    Нет 24.
     
    #38
  19. trir

    Форумчанин

    Регистрация:
    25 ноя 2014
    Сообщения:
    3.253
    Симпатии:
    931
    Адрес:
    gnomtrir@mail.ru
    там web merctor
     
    #39
  20. Izekinvitro

    Регистрация:
    24 июл 2018
    Сообщения:
    17
    Симпатии:
    2
    Что это значит и почему точечные слои определяются нормально, а полигоны так как определяются?
     
    #40

Поделиться этой страницей

  1. Этот сайт использует файлы cookie. Продолжая пользоваться данным сайтом, Вы соглашаетесь на использование нами Ваших файлов cookie.
    Скрыть объявление